Transaction e3ac0c815376a99d96c893ae4bf6d4bca7600e929fcf1beef57ca742456cecb3
1 Input
1 Output
-
e3ac0c815376a99d96c893ae4bf6d4bca7600e929fcf1beef57ca742456cecb3:0
- value
- 1949428
- script pubkey
- OP_0 OP_PUSHBYTES_20 87cd53a623a4c0e868f32d9f61aa7ea948db6b3f
- address
- bc1qslx48f3r5nqws68n9k0kr2n749ydk6el7hgr5z